1/3 Scale Classic Macintosh Made With Raspberry Pi

Wednesday August 28, 2013 10:29 am PDT by
John Leake, co-host of the RetroMacCast, has crafted a 1/3 scale miniature replica of the Mac Plus (via Cult of Mac). The computer, which he calls the "Mini Mac", is made from a Raspberry Pi, PVC, and a Linux-based Mac emulator running System 6. Pandora to Remove 40-Hour Free Listening Limit Ahead of iTunes Radio Launch

Thursday August 22, 2013 3:24 pm PDT by
During today's earnings call, Pandora CFO Mike Herring said the company will again allow unlimited listening via mobile devices, eliminating its recently implemented monthly cap. First introduced in February, Pandora's 40-hour per month limit was put in place as a direct result of increased royalty rates.
